Stir Scotch, Apple Brandy, Ramazzotti, Apricot Brandy with ice. Strain into a coupe.
Inspired by Eric Alperin's Skid Row with its Ramazzotti-apricot pairing, I decided to swap out Genever for Scotch, which works well with Ramazzotti in the Black Scottish Cyclops, and aged apple brandy, known for its compatibility with apricot liqueur. Rather than naming it after a Boston skid row, I chose to honor a notorious underground operation during Prohibition by calling it Club Garden, after a famous speakeasy raided in 1932 near the Boston Garden arena.
